    About The Cajun Army: The Cajun Army is a 501C3 organization founded days after the Great Flood of 2016. Using volunteer labor, the group works to gut homes and provide support to those affected by flooding and other natural disasters. The Cajun Army does not solicit monetary donations. Donations of supplies are accepted. A listing of needed items is available

    on an Amazon Wishlist at the time of each deployment.
